Linux Aliases在系统管理中有多种应用,它们可以简化命令行操作、提高工作效率,并允许管理员根据需要自定义命令。以下是一些常见的应用场景:
ls -l
简写为ll
。alias ll='ls -l'
ll
时,实际上执行的是ls -l
命令。alias backup='tar czvf backup_$(date +%Y%m%d).tar.gz /path/to/backup'
backup
即可完成备份和压缩操作。alias proj='cd /path/to/project'
proj
即可直接跳转到项目目录。alias setenv='export PATH=$PATH:/new/path'
setenv
后,PATH
环境变量会包含新的路径。alias logs='tail -f /var/log/service.log'
logs
即可实时查看服务日志。alias pinghost='ping -c 4 google.com'
pinghost
即可对指定主机进行四次ping测试。alias cleantmp='rm -rf /tmp/*'
cleantmp
即可删除/tmp
目录下的所有内容(注意:使用时要非常小心)。alias runscript='bash /path/to/script.sh'
runscript
即可执行指定的脚本。alias chmod755='chmod 755'
chmod755 filename
即可将文件权限设置为rwxr-xr-x
。alias mkdirp='mkdir -p'
mkdir
不支持-p
选项,但通过别名可以确保跨平台兼容性。~/.bashrc
、~/.bash_profile
或~/.profile
文件中。通过合理使用Linux Aliases,系统管理员可以显著提高工作效率并简化日常任务。